You might add a vapor barrier/ sound deadener (treated cardboard) as spacer behind the door cards if you cant find anything else. My 55 vinyl is tight against the door handles to the point you have to be careful not to catch it with the spring removal tool. A lot of differences between a 55 and a 58 so what you have maybe correct. I also have a clear plastic washer between the door handle and door card that protects the card from abrasion during turning of the that I don't see on your door..... Tedd

There is usually a coil spring behind the card on the stem of the window or door handle shaft. Depending on what series of Olds you have (88, S88, 98) would determine the interior style, pattern and fabric you would get in the original car. Quite a bit of difference. Plane jane to pretty plush.

The small end goes against the door and large end to the card. Takes a bit of fussing to hold the spring in place and fit the card. Helps to have a lot of fingers.
